在 CentOS 中,deluser 命令主要用于删除用户账户,而不是直接删除组。如果你想删除一个组,可以使用 groupdel 命令。以下是使用 groupdel 删除组的步骤:
-
查看现有组:
在删除组之前,你可以先列出系统中的所有组,以确认要删除的组名。可以使用以下命令:getent group或者
cat /etc/group -
删除组:
使用groupdel命令删除指定的组。例如,要删除名为oldgroup的组,可以运行:sudo groupdel oldgroup如果该组中还有用户,你需要先将这些用户从该组中移除,或者使用
-r选项来强制删除(这会同时删除组及其所属的用户):sudo groupdel -r oldgroup -
验证组是否已删除:
再次运行getent group或cat /etc/group来确认组已被成功删除。
请注意,删除组之前要确保没有用户属于该组,或者已经重新分配了这些用户到其他组,以避免潜在的问题。